Output 640ef1d3e4e0109cd986acfc00cebf321e2d1d8fdcd13aa660c26f69fd931d61:0

value
125000
script pubkey
OP_0 OP_PUSHBYTES_20 dc17bd7a444c467925839f68f6ca0b1a2793518f
address
tb1qmstm67jyf3r8jfvrna50djstrgnex5v0a4zyza
transaction
640ef1d3e4e0109cd986acfc00cebf321e2d1d8fdcd13aa660c26f69fd931d61
confirmations
17509
spent
true